Offshore wind farms have surged in popularity over the last decade, and for good reason. Unlike their onshore cousins, these turbines tap into stronger and more consistent winds over the ocean, which means more reliable electricity generation. Plus, they’re tucked away from urban centers, sidestepping some of the land use conflicts and aesthetic concerns that often come up with onshore wind projects.
Building out offshore wind capabilities isn’t without its challenges. Installing massive turbines hundreds of feet tall in deep, choppy waters demands cutting-edge engineering and hefty investment. Then there’s the task of connecting these farms to the mainland grid, which involves underwater cables buried deep beneath the seabed. But advances in technology and growing economies of scale are steadily trimming costs and boosting efficiency.

The environmental benefits are significant. Offshore wind farms produce clean energy that reduces reliance on fossil fuels, thus lowering greenhouse gas emissions. They also avoid many of the air and noise pollution issues tied to traditional power plants. Some studies even suggest that the turbine foundations can serve as artificial reefs, fostering marine biodiversity.
Yet, it’s important to acknowledge the concerns too. The impact on local bird populations and marine life remains an area of active research. Plus, the visual impact on seascapes triggers debates among coastal communities and tourists who cherish unobstructed ocean views.
Despite these challenges, the trajectory is clear. Governments and companies worldwide are committing billions to offshore wind projects. Countries like the UK, Germany, and China are leading the pack, but emerging markets are rapidly joining the fray. As energy demands grow and the urgency of climate change intensifies, offshore wind farms stand poised to play an increasingly vital role in balancing our grid and greening our future.
